Know-how in a nutshell

The step-by-step series that brings expert advice at an affordable price

Breaks down gardening basics into 101 easy-to-grasp tips

Gives quick answers to all questions

Each point can be absorbed in an instant

Holy Moses, what a barn burningly good read!!!

Just kidding. It's a book about gardening. By law I don't think it's allowed to be interesting.

It is however fairly informative, though on a very basic level as the title suggests. I constantly found myself finishing the ultra concise passages thinking, "okay, thank you for that...but why?"

Basic Gardening gives the novice gardener the barest of essentials to get your plants planted, your lawn laid, and your fruit trees funky...sorry, I was trying to maintain the alliteration, an abhorrent practice in the best of times. Anywhoodle, Basic Gardening is a quick read, perfect for that first step towards a greener backyard.

Rating: Perhaps it deserves a higher rating considering it does what it sets out to do. Meh, it's an informative-yet-boring textbook...3.5 stars!

Great book for people who want to learn a little bit about gardening.
It's not overwhelming with just enough information to wet your appetite so if you want more you have a starting point.
